HotelsClick.com

Hotel Alpha Bird Nha Trang - Nha Trang Vietnam - Photos

» Hotel Alpha Bird Nha Trang - Nha Trang Vietnam

Booking.com

No photos

Hotel Alpha Bird Nha Trang - Nha Trang Vietnam - Search and Book Hotel

78/44 Tue Tinh Street, Loc Tho Ward,
65000 Nha Trang
Hotels 3 Stars Vietnam